Transaction 72b82b2261a7123fd724b186c32fddb41d8229cbb08a86b84a5ca14ecf6339af
1 Input
2 Outputs
- 72b82b2261a7123fd724b186c32fddb41d8229cbb08a86b84a5ca14ecf6339af:0
- 72b82b2261a7123fd724b186c32fddb41d8229cbb08a86b84a5ca14ecf6339af:1
value 76510
address 3DtuhvAibFtZAgwEEsKdLfMDJDscgr5oti
value 53690788
address 32FdtU52duxkwGGSRJ5NuLqYUi2qJfqot1